Job Title: Salesforce Engineer

Location: London, UK (Hybrid - 3 days onsite per week) Contract Type: Contract (Inside IR35) Duration: 6 months minimum Day Rate: Up to £450 per day Start Date: Immediate or negotiable

Role Overview

We're hiring a seasoned Salesforce Engineer to support the delivery of scalable, high-quality solutions within a mature Salesforce org for a leading UK financial institution. This is a hands-on engineering role focused on designing, building, and deploying features across Service Cloud, OmniStudio, and Lightning frameworks, while maintaining compliance with strict governance and regulatory standards.

You'll work within a collaborative feature team, contributing to technical design, mentoring junior developers, and owning delivery from development through to production. The environment is fast-paced, agile, and outcome-driven-ideal for someone who thrives under pressure and takes pride in building robust, enterprise-grade Salesforce solutions.

Key Responsibilities
  • Design and document scalable technical solutions in collaboration with architects and business stakeholders
  • Configure and customize Salesforce using best practices, minimizing unnecessary custom code
  • Develop and maintain Aura and Lightning Web Components (LWC) using Apex
  • Build and enhance business processes using OmniStudio tools
  • Own the full delivery life cycle-"you build it, you own it"-from development to deployment
  • Mentor junior engineers and promote best practices across the team
  • Contribute to test case development and ensure high-quality, production-ready code
  • Address technical debt and maintain platform stability and scalability
  • Use version control (Git) and deployment tools (Salesforce CLI, DX, Copado, Gearset) effectively
  • Perform data imports, exports, and queries using Salesforce data management tools
  • Participate in agile ceremonies and collaborate across cross-functional teams
Required Experience & Skills
  • 7+ years of Salesforce platform development
  • 5+ years building Aura and LWC components using Apex
  • 2+ years hands-on experience with OmniStudio
  • Strong technical design skills and experience working with architects
  • Advanced Git proficiency (branching, merging, conflict resolution)
  • Experience with Salesforce deployment tools and CI/CD workflows
  • Proficient in SOQL/SOSL, Flow Builder, and metadata inspection tools
  • Familiarity with Salesforce data tools (Data Loader, Workbench, Import Wizard)
  • Deep understanding of Salesforce best practices and governance in regulated environments
  • Agile/Scrum delivery experience
